        # `nirfsg`
        Python control of NI RF Signal Generators using NI-RFSG
        
        ## Installation
        
            > pip install nirfsg
        
        Or, after cloning repo:
        
            > pip install .
        
        ## Documentation
        Currently supported models:
        - PXIe-5654
        
        
        ```
        > from nirfsg import PXIe_5654
        > sig_gen = PXIe_5654(<resource>)
        > sig_gen.rf_frequency = 2e6 # Hz
        > sig_gen.rf_power = 0 # dBm
        > sig_gen.initiate()
        ...
        > sig_gen.close()
        ```
        
        As a context manager:
        
        ```
        > with PXIe_5654(<resource>) as sig_gen:
            sig_gen.rf_frequency = 20e9 # Hz
            sig_gen.rf_power = 13 # dBm
            sig_gen.initiate()
            # do some measurements
        ```
        
        Context manager will close the session at exit, which will stop generation.
